Huons Meditech, a medical device specialist under the Huons Group, has intensified its academic marketing efforts for the 'DermaShine' series of aesthetic medical devices, targeting both domestic and international medical professionals.
The company announced on May 11 that it participated in the 'K-Beauty Advanced Skill Training Workshop 2026' (K.A.T China 2026) and the '2026 Spring Academic Conference of the Korean Society of Filler'.
K.A.T China 2026, held from May 8 to 10 at the Eighth People's Hospital affiliated with Shenyang Medical University in Shenyang, China, is a workshop where Korean medical professionals demonstrate device procedures for Chinese clinicians. The event attracted around 120 participants, including medical staff from the Eighth People's Hospital, dermatologists and plastic surgeons from Shenyang, and government officials.
At K.A.T China 2026, Huons Meditech demonstrated procedures using the 'DermaShine Balance', a skin drug quantitative injector that has sold over 10,000 units in the Chinese market, along with 'Hutox', a botulinum toxin formulation from Huons BioPharma. The company also showcased its 'Premium 9-Pin Needle', which recently received approval from China's National Medical Products Administration (NMPA).
The 2026 Spring Academic Conference of the Korean Society of Filler, held from May 9 to 10 at the ST Center in Seoul, is an academic event where domestic aesthetic medical professionals share the latest treatment trends and clinical experiences using fillers, skin boosters, and energy-based devices.
At this conference, Huons Meditech focused on the 'DermaShine Duo RF', which combines precision injection with radiofrequency (RF) lifting capabilities, engaging in academic exchanges with clinicians on device operation strategies and treatment approaches applicable in real clinical settings.
Dr. Park Sang-hyuk from Laplas Clinic gave a lecture titled 'Clinical Significance of Simultaneous Application of Vacuum-assisted Microneedle RF and Skin Booster'. He introduced various approaches for using aesthetic devices like the DermaShine Duo RF and emphasized the importance of device selection and treatment design based on actual clinical experience.
